Finding True AI File Creation Date

Is there a way to find the true and original creation date of an illustrator file?  Or is the metadata changed when a file is "Saved As"?

When you do as SaveAs, you are essentially saying, this is a brand new file created right now.

Keep your SaveAs file as the back-up, and carry on working on the original file which has the original creation date.

In Illustrator the creation date cannot be changed (except when you do a Save As, but that's when you create a new file). Unfortunately Mac OS does not show the real creation date (when the file is just saved) with Cmd I, but Bridge and Illustrator do.
